Advertisement

51单片机具备清零、启动和暂停等多种功能,且已实现代码验证。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
利用六个LED进行显示,能够呈现时间范围从00:00到59:59.99秒的精确计时。该计时系统具备0.01秒的精度,能够准确地记录并展现计时状态以及最终结果。软件程序的核心部分采用C语言进行开发,涵盖了时间显示程序、初始化子程序、键盘扫描程序、中断服务程序以及延时处理子程序等模块,并且这些代码均在Keil环境下进行编译和运行。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 51秒表含(附
    优质
    本项目设计了一款基于51单片机的智能秒表程序,具备清零、启动和暂停三大核心功能。文中不仅详细介绍了实现原理,还提供了经过验证的完整代码供读者参考学习。 六位LED显示时间范围为00.00至59分99.99秒,计时精度达到0.01秒。该系统能够准确地进行计时并展示相应的状态和结果。软件代码使用C语言编写,包括显示程序、初始化子程序、键盘扫描程序、中断服务程序以及延时子程序等,并在Keil环境中实现。
  • 基于的秒表
    优质
    本项目设计了一款基于单片机控制的数字秒表,实现精确计时、启动及暂停功能。用户通过简单操作即可便捷地使用该设备进行时间测量,适用于多种场景需求。 基于单片机的秒表启动和暂停功能可以使用C语言代码实现。对于希望利用单片机开发秒表功能的同学来说,设计秒表的暂停与启动部分可以参考以下方法。
  • 51利用一按键达成恢复
    优质
    本项目介绍了一种使用51单片机实现通过一个按键控制程序暂停与恢复的技术方案,适用于需要简单有效控制系统的设计。 51单片机通过一个按键来实现暂停与恢复功能。
  • 在FPGA中51核心,
    优质
    本项目在FPGA平台上成功实现了51单片机的核心功能,并通过实验验证了其正确性和可靠性。 在FPGA内构建了51单片机内核,并且已经测试通过,可以正常使用。
  • 51蜂鸣器播放、及切换音乐
    优质
    本项目介绍如何使用51单片机编程控制蜂鸣器播放、暂停以及切换不同音调和节奏的音乐,为初学者提供实用教程。 使用51单片机的蜂鸣器可以播放三首音乐:《送别》、爬音阶练习曲以及《八月桂花》。当然也可以更换其他乐曲,只需要将谱输入到数组中即可。在程序运行过程中,通过外部中断来暂停音乐,并且利用独立按键选择不同的歌曲。调试结果显示该程序是可行的。其中蜂鸣器连接至P1.5引脚,独立按键一连接至P3.2(用作外部中断0)以实现播放暂停功能;另外两个独立按键分别接在P0.1和P0.0上用于选择音乐曲目。
  • JavaScript计时器、重
    优质
    本教程介绍如何使用JavaScript实现计时器的基本操作,包括启动、暂停和重启等功能,帮助开发者轻松添加时间管理功能到网页应用中。 计时器的实现包括开始计时、停止计时和重置功能。
  • 使用Qt计时器的继续
    优质
    本项目利用Qt框架开发了一个具备启动、暂停及继续功能的计时器应用程序。通过简洁直观的界面,用户可以轻松控制计时过程,并灵活调整时间设置。 利用Qt实现计时器的启动、暂停与继续功能,在Qt5及以上版本中可以正常使用。
  • 51STC89C52RC开发板秒表程序(带).rar
    优质
    本资源提供基于51单片机STC89C52RC开发板设计的带有暂停功能的秒表程序,适用于初学者学习和实践嵌入式系统编程。 51单片机STC89C52RC开发板例程之秒表可暂停 1. 单片机型号:STC89C52RC。 2. 开发环境:KEIL。 3. 编程语言:C语言。 4. 提供配套PDF格式的51单片机STC89C52RC开发板电路原理图。 5. 功能描述: - 实现计时功能,最大计时时长为99小时; - 支持暂停功能,按下键盘左下角S7键可暂停计时;按压S12键则继续计时。 注意事项:晶振需设定为11.0592MHz。若使用其他频率的晶振,请调整TH0与TL0参数值以避免较大的计时误差。
  • 秒表课程设计 控制与复位
    优质
    本课程设计介绍了一种基于单片机的秒表系统,重点讲解了其暂停控制和复位清零功能的实现方法和技术细节。 可以控制暂停以及复位清零,打包了两个程序供你选择,功能都很全面,请随意挑选,保证不会雷同。
  • 化的JAR包脚本,
    优质
    这段文字介绍了一个自动化管理JAR包的启停过程的脚本工具,该工具还支持设置为系统服务,在电脑启动时自动运行。 本脚本旨在提升生产环境中大量启动jar包的效率。通过参数设置可以实现目录下所有jar包的循环启动或指定单个目录下的jar包启动。适用于需要频繁操作多个jar包的运维人员,以及希望设置开机自启功能的人群。 使用方法如下: 1. 执行命令 `sh autoStart.sh` 可以一次性启动当前目录下的所有jar文件。 2. 若要仅运行特定目录内的jar文件,请执行类似 `sh autoStart.sh /home/issue/svr-test` 的指令,这将针对 `/home/issue/svr-test` 目录进行操作并启动其中的jar包。 3. 若已将其注册为服务,则可以通过命令 `service autoStart.sh /home/issue/svr-test` 启动指定目录下的jar文件。